What is a kilowatt-hour (kWh)?
Kilowatt-hours (kWh) are a unit of energy. One kilowatt-hour is equal to the energy used to maintain one kilowatt of power for one hour. Generally, when discussing the cost of electricity, we talk in terms of energy.
What is a kilowatt hour?
A kilowatt hour (kWh) is the amount of power that device will use over the course of an hour. Here’s an example: If you have a 1,000 watt drill, it takes 1,000 watts (or one kW) to make it work. If you run that drill for one hour, you’ll have used up one kilowatt of energy for that hour, or one kWh. What Can 1 Kilowatt-Hour Power?
How many kilowatts are in a kWh?
A kilowatt (kW) is 1,000 watts and is a measure of how much power something needs to run. In metric, 1,000 = kilo, so 1,000 watts equals a kilowatt. A kilowatt hour (kWh) is a measure of the amount of energy something uses over time. A kilowatt (kW) is the amount of power something needs just to turn it on.
How do you calculate energy use in kilowatt-hours?
1 kilowatt-hour = using 1,000 watts for 1 hour So, if you run something that uses 1,000 watts for 1 hour, you’ve used 1 kWh. But most appliances use different wattages, and you might run them for just a few minutes or several hours — that’s where calculating comes in. Is kWh a unit of energy?
The kWh is a unit of energy. (A physicist might throw their arms up in disgust at how we've over-simplified one of the fundamentals of the universe. But fortunately we're not writing this for physicists) The kilowatt hour (kWh) is a unit of energy The Calorie is a unit of energy And the joule (J) is a unit of energy
Should you convert watts to watt-hours with a portable power station?
The ability to convert watts to watt-hours is invaluable when using solar panels with a portable power station. It aids in correctly sizing your solar array, estimating charge times, managing daily energy use, and ensuring a reliable power supply in off-grid or emergency situations.
